数据库中dbms是什么

不及物动词 其他 60

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    DBMS是数据库管理系统的缩写,它是一种软件,用于管理和操作数据库。DBMS允许用户创建、访问和维护数据库,同时提供了一套工具和方法来管理数据,确保数据的完整性、安全性和一致性。

    以下是关于DBMS的几个重要方面:

    1. 数据库创建和管理:DBMS允许用户创建数据库,定义数据库的结构和模式。用户可以定义表、字段、索引等数据库对象,并设置数据类型、约束和关系。DBMS还提供了管理和维护数据库的功能,如备份、恢复、优化和性能监控。

    2. 数据访问和查询:DBMS提供了一种标准化的查询语言,如SQL(Structured Query Language),用于访问和操作数据库中的数据。用户可以使用SQL语句进行数据的插入、更新、删除和查询。DBMS还提供了高级查询功能,如联接、子查询和聚合函数,以支持复杂的数据分析和报表生成。

    3. 数据安全和权限控制:DBMS提供了安全机制来保护数据库中的数据。用户可以设置访问权限,限制不同用户对数据的操作和查看范围。DBMS还可以对数据进行加密和身份验证,以防止未经授权的访问和数据泄露。

    4. 数据完整性和一致性:DBMS通过实施约束和规则来确保数据的完整性和一致性。用户可以定义数据的约束条件,如主键、外键和唯一约束,以保证数据的正确性和一致性。DBMS还可以自动检查和修复数据错误,以避免数据损坏和冲突。

    5. 并发控制和事务管理:DBMS可以处理多个用户同时对数据库进行操作的情况。它使用并发控制机制来管理数据的共享和访问冲突,以确保数据的一致性和完整性。DBMS还支持事务管理,允许用户将一系列操作组合为一个原子性的操作单元,以保证数据的一致性和可靠性。

    总之,DBMS是数据库管理系统,它提供了一套工具和方法来管理和操作数据库。通过DBMS,用户可以创建和管理数据库,访问和查询数据,保护数据安全,确保数据的完整性和一致性,以及处理并发操作和事务管理。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,DBMS是指数据库管理系统(Database Management System)的缩写。DBMS是一种软件系统,用于管理和组织数据库。它允许用户定义、创建、维护和控制数据库的访问。DBMS提供了一系列的功能,包括数据定义语言(DDL)、数据操作语言(DML)、数据查询语言(DQL)和数据控制语言(DCL)等。

    DBMS的主要功能包括数据定义、数据存储和管理、数据操作和查询、数据安全和完整性控制、并发控制和事务管理等。

    首先,DBMS提供了数据定义语言(DDL),允许用户定义数据库的结构和模式。用户可以创建表、定义字段和数据类型、设置约束和索引等。DDL还允许用户修改和删除数据库对象。

    其次,DBMS负责数据的存储和管理。它将数据存储在磁盘或其他存储介质上,并管理数据的物理存储结构。DBMS还负责数据的备份和恢复,以确保数据的可靠性和可用性。

    然后,DBMS提供了数据操作和查询功能。用户可以使用数据操作语言(DML)来插入、更新和删除数据。数据查询语言(DQL)允许用户查询和检索数据。DBMS还提供了强大的查询优化功能,以提高查询性能。

    此外,DBMS还负责数据的安全和完整性控制。它允许用户定义访问权限和角色,以限制对数据库的访问。DBMS还可以实施数据完整性约束,以确保数据的一致性和有效性。

    DBMS还提供并发控制和事务管理功能。并发控制用于处理多个用户同时访问数据库的情况,以防止数据冲突和不一致性。事务管理允许用户将一系列操作组合成一个逻辑单元,以确保数据的一致性和完整性。

    总结来说,DBMS是一种用于管理和组织数据库的软件系统。它提供了数据定义、数据存储和管理、数据操作和查询、数据安全和完整性控制、并发控制和事务管理等功能,以帮助用户有效地管理和利用数据库。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    DBMS是数据库管理系统(Database Management System)的缩写。它是一种用于管理和操作数据库的软件系统。DBMS允许用户创建、更新、存储和检索数据库中的数据。它提供了一种结构化的方法来组织、存储和管理大量的数据,以便于数据的访问和使用。

    DBMS的主要目标是提供一种可靠、高效和安全的方法来管理数据库。它提供了一系列的功能和工具,使用户能够轻松地处理数据库中的数据。以下是DBMS的一些主要功能:

    1. 数据定义语言(DDL):DDL允许用户定义和管理数据库中的数据结构。它包括创建表、定义字段、设置约束等操作。

    2. 数据操作语言(DML):DML用于对数据库中的数据进行操作。它包括插入、更新、删除和查询数据的操作。

    3. 数据库查询语言(SQL):SQL是一种标准化的数据库查询语言,用于从数据库中检索数据。它允许用户通过指定条件和关联表来查询所需的数据。

    4. 数据完整性:DBMS提供了一些机制来确保数据的完整性,例如定义唯一键、外键和检查约束等。

    5. 数据安全性:DBMS提供了一些安全机制来保护数据库中的数据,例如用户身份验证、访问控制和数据加密等。

    6. 并发控制:DBMS允许多个用户同时访问和操作数据库,而不会引起数据冲突。它提供了一些并发控制机制,如锁和事务处理。

    7. 数据备份和恢复:DBMS提供了数据备份和恢复的功能,以防止数据丢失或损坏。它可以定期备份数据库,并在需要时恢复数据。

    操作DBMS的流程如下:

    1. 安装和配置DBMS软件:首先,需要选择合适的DBMS软件,并按照其安装指南进行安装和配置。

    2. 创建数据库:使用DBMS提供的DDL语句,创建数据库并定义表结构、字段和约束等。

    3. 插入数据:使用DML语句向数据库中插入数据。

    4. 查询和更新数据:使用DML语句查询和更新数据库中的数据。

    5. 管理数据完整性:使用DBMS提供的机制,如定义唯一键和外键来确保数据的完整性。

    6. 管理用户权限:使用DBMS提供的访问控制机制,管理用户对数据库的访问权限。

    7. 备份和恢复数据:使用DBMS提供的备份和恢复功能,定期备份数据库,并在需要时恢复数据。

    总结:DBMS是一种用于管理和操作数据库的软件系统。它提供了一系列的功能和工具,使用户能够轻松地处理数据库中的数据。操作DBMS的流程包括安装和配置DBMS软件、创建数据库、插入和查询数据、管理数据完整性、管理用户权限以及备份和恢复数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部